Takeoff at 23:04 for an operation to Köln, Germany.
Shot down by night fighter pilot Hauptmann Siegfried Wandam of the Stab I./NJG 5 (detached to II./NJG 1), flying Bf 110 G-4 C9+AB from St Trond (Sint-Truiden) airfield.
This was Wandam's last victory. During this combat, the left engine was hit by return fire. Nine minutes after the crash of the Halifax, the Messerschmitt hit the ground when trying to land at St Trond airfield and both crew members were killed.
